Abstract
The utility model relates to a miniature chlorine dioxide gasification and disinfection device, and belongs to the technical field of sanitary disinfection apparatuses. The utility model is used for solving the problem of space disinfection. The utility model comprises a box body for loading chlorine dioxide solution. The upper part of the box body is provided with a chlorine dioxide gas exhaust opening. After improved, a disinfection device is provided with a gas flow generation mechanism which is positioned outside the box body. The utility model utilizes the gas flow generation mechanism to force the chlorine dioxide solution of the container to intensely writhe, the chlorine dioxide molecules rapidly escape from the interior of the solution to the exterior, lots of chlorine dioxide gas is generated and the function of space disinfection is performed. The utility model has the characteristics of high liquid-gas conversion rate, simple structure, low cost, convenient use, indirect contact of the gas flow generation mechanism and the chlorine dioxide solution, easy maintenance and long service life. The utility model is widely used for the space sanitary disinfection of hospitals, enterprises, families, schools and various public occasions.

Background technology
Chlorine dioxide be internationally recognized a kind of efficient, wide spectrum, quick, nontoxic the 4th generation disinfection sanitizer.The field that chlorine dioxide is used is very extensive, and wherein, solution is the common disinfection way of chlorine dioxide, direct immersion or the atomized spray kill bacteria, virus of sterilization objects by ClO 2 solution.This disinfection way acts on body surface beyond doubt effectively, but it is just so uneasy to want to kill effectively spatial plankton.Reason is: it is resident for a long time to be difficult in the space with the vaporific disinfectant of present technological means, it is very fast to fall heavy speed, and disinfectant render a service the concentration directly be limited by disinfectant and action time these two factors, if can't make disinfectant resident for a long time in the space, " concentration " and " time " this key element are with uncontrollable, and the space disinfection effect does not just have collateral security yet.Using gaseous chlorine dioxide to carry out space disinfection can address this problem effectively, because chlorine dioxide can spread rapidly in the space, also resides at the space for a long time with the air uniform mixing, and does not have the dead angle and can say.ClO 2 solution after the activation is unsettled, chlorine dioxide is easy to overflow from solution, common " fumigating " sterilization is just based on this principle, the ClO 2 solution activation of high concentration is placed in the open-top receptacle, and nationality helps the natural dissipation of chlorine dioxide can implement space disinfection.But the generation of the uncontrollable chlorine dioxide of this way, the concentration of promptly uncontrollable space chlorine dioxide, Disinfection Effect is unknown, and " liquid-gas " conversion ratio is very low, and therefore, there are a lot of drawbacks in this natural fumigation method.

The specific embodiment
This utility model is little, the lightweight maintenance decontaminating apparatus of a kind of volume, and overall structure is very simple.Comprise the casing 1 and the air-flow generating mechanism of splendid attire ClO 2 solution in the formation, be provided with chlorine dioxide outlet 3 on casing top.Air-flow generating mechanism shown in Figure 1 adopts blower fan 2, and blower fan is arranged in the blower fan mouth on casing top.This structure, no any attachedly directly contacts with disinfectant solution, so be easy to safeguard, long service life.ClO 2 solution is distributed as flat pattern in container, the liquid level wind area is bigger, helps under the effect of air-flow chlorine dioxide and overflows in solution.Air-flow generating mechanism shown in Figure 2 adopts air pump 5, and air pump is positioned at casing top, and it exports connectivity trachea 6, is provided with pit 7 at box bottom, and the trachea port is arranged in pit, this structure, as long as inject small amount of liquid, decontaminating apparatus just can operate as normal.
This utility model requires to inject water purification and an amount of powder chlorine dioxide from gas discharge outlet 3 according to spatial volume and sterilization in use, activates 5 minutes, and the concentration of the ClO 2 solution of preparing is not less than 2000mg/L.Start blower fan or air pump, solution acutely seethes under air-flow stirs, make the enough kinetic energy of chlorine dioxide molecule acquisition in the solution, promote its " work function ", violent seethe and can greatly increase interfacial area between water and the air, promote its " escape probability ", both the effect the result, impel the chlorine dioxide molecule apace in solution to outer effusion.Along with solution concentration constantly reduces, chlorine dioxide is from constantly outwards ejection of air vent.Arrive the scheduled time, shut down, residual liquid is diluted in water filling, and pours out residual liquid from leakage fluid dram 4.
